Early Years Educators support young children’s growth through play-based learning, monitor development, and create safe environments. They need knowledge of child development, strong communication, and patience. Basic childcare qualifications are necessary.

Teaching Assistants support teachers by delivering lessons, managing classroom behaviour, and aiding pupil learning. They need experience with educational support, understanding of curriculum frameworks, and effective communication skills to foster a positive learning environment.

Nursery Room Leaders oversee daily child care, guide early learning plans, and support staff development. They need proven early years education experience, knowledge of safeguarding practices, and strong communication skills to foster inclusive, safe environments.
